professionally
01
in a way that relates to someone's career, job, or occupation
Examples
Professionally, she's known for her expertise in financial law.
He has grown tremendously professionally over the past few years.
1.1
in a skilled, competent, or businesslike manner
Examples
The interview was conducted very professionally.
They responded to the complaint professionally and promptly.
1.2
by someone with the required qualifications, experience, or training
Examples
The website should be professionally redesigned.
The house was professionally cleaned before the guests arrived.
02
as part of one's paid employment and not as a hobby or volunteer activity
Examples
She began dancing professionally at the age of sixteen.
He never thought he 'd write professionally, but now it's his main job.
